Step 4 — Migrate relevance tuning notes into Searchcraft 3. Export the old boost tables from the Tumblewood index, review each synonym expansion for injection-prone wildcards, and confirm the re-ranker weights were approved in the last audit cycle. Field-level permissions must be re-declared explicitly; nothing is inherited. Once the notes are imported, validate against the settings shown directly below.

config for taguf-tafof:
zorath:
  log_level: error
  metrics_host: metrics.zorath.zemvarlabs.internal
  pin: 5550
  pool_size: 32

**Ticket VND-204: Restock planner release sign-off needed.** The Snackroute vending-machine restock planner has a revised demand forecast model ready for the 2.3 release. Changes affect route ordering and low-stock thresholds; regression tests pass and a two-week pilot showed no anomalies. Before the release manager can cut the build, formal sign-off is required from:

named custodian: Brivan Eliath Quenox Frador

## Deployment Notes

This release fixes the Wrenlet gateway bug where websocket clients failed to reconnect after a rolling deploy, because the old backoff cap was shorter than the drain window. Reviewers should confirm the reconnect jitter logic in `socket_core.vx`. Deploys now require the updated gateway settings, reproduced here for reference.

settings of fafog-haduf:
ZORIX_PIN=4648
ZORIX_METRICS_HOST=metrics.zorix.paliqsys.corp
ZORIX_LOG_LEVEL=info
ZORIX_TENANT=druix

- [ ] Verify the order-cutoff rule for Crumbleton Bakeries before shipping. Orders placed after 2:00 p.m. local store time must roll to the next baking day, and the cutoff is evaluated per store, not per warehouse — this caught out the last contractor. Test with at least one store in a half-hour timezone offset. Confirm the confirmation email shows the rolled date, not the order date. When all checks pass, record the build you verified against directly below this item.

build token for yajof-bajof: htk31_506ff1188f74596b5bb2eec94edc43c